寻源宝典玩转FPGA必备数电知识
上海瑞力特传动科技有限公司坐落于上海市金山区,专注进口轴承领域,主营SKF、NSK、FAG等国际一线品牌,覆盖工业传动全场景需求。公司自2021年成立以来,依托原厂直供体系与高效供应链,为机械制造、自动化设备等行业客户提供高精度轴承解决方案,以权威资质与专业服务赢得市场信赖。
本文系统梳理FPGA开发所需的数字电路核心知识,包括逻辑门电路、时序设计原理和硬件描述语言基础,帮助初学者快速构建知识框架,为FPGA学习打下坚实基础。
一、逻辑门电路是地基
FPGA的本质是可编程逻辑门阵列,掌握这些基础元件就像玩积木前先认识方块:
与或非门:组合逻辑的三大支柱,任何复杂电路都由此搭建
触发器与锁存器:构成时序电路的记忆单元,理解时钟边沿触发是关键
多路选择器:数据流控制的交通警察,简化复杂逻辑设计
编码器/译码器:信息转换的翻译官,7段数码管显示就靠它
二、时序设计像交响乐
让数字电路和谐工作的秘诀在于掌握时序节奏:
时钟域交叉:处理不同节奏的信号如同指挥协调乐器声部
建立保持时间:数据与时钟的华尔兹,错过节拍就会出错
同步复位策略:电路重启的安全气囊,避免系统进入混沌状态
流水线优化:像工厂流水线般提升效率,但需平衡速度与面积
三、硬件描述语言是画笔
用代码绘制电路图需要特殊语法技巧:
阻塞/非阻塞赋值:区分=和<=如同分清铅笔与马克笔
有限状态机:用case语句描述智能体的行为模式
参数化设计:宏定义让代码像乐高般可复用
testbench编写:给自己的电路设计自动化测试用例
爱采购产品信息全面,爱采购能帮你快速找到参考,其中对比功能可能对你有帮助,各位老板快去试试吧~

